    If you owe back child support, you could face jail time. Here's how this works. Contempt of Court for Failure to Pay Court-Ordered Child Support. Failure to obey a court order is called contempt of court. If you owe unpaid child support, the other parent can ask for a hearing before a judge and ask that you be held in contempt of court.

    Jun 21, 2019 · The period of time for incarceration is generally considered: A minimum amount of time The amount of time it takes to ensure the child support payments will be paid in the future Usually not more than six months

    In Alabama, child support enforcement must take place within 20 years from date of judgment for purpose of obtaining an order of support. AL Statute of Limitations on Determining Paternity Paternity must be determined in Alabama by the child’s 19th birthday.

    Sep 23, 2019 · If you're looking at jail time and don't think you'll be able to make your payments you can ask the court to suspend your child support order. Whether you or your ex is the one who'll be serving time in jail you should probably reevaluate the child support order, prior to incarceration.
